Math Problem Statement

Find the correct numbers to fill in the blanks to unlock puzzle two. The missing numbers in each question form a code.

Solution

Let's solve the puzzle step by step by filling in the missing numbers.

  1. -11 + ____ = 15
    To solve for the blank:
    11+x=15    x=15+11=26-11 + x = 15 \implies x = 15 + 11 = 26
    Answer: 26

  2. ____ - (-3) = 5
    To solve for the blank:
    x+3=5    x=53=2x + 3 = 5 \implies x = 5 - 3 = 2
    Answer: 2

  3. ____ + (-4) = 7
    To solve for the blank:
    x4=7    x=7+4=11x - 4 = 7 \implies x = 7 + 4 = 11
    Answer: 11

  4. ____ + (-8) = -3
    To solve for the blank:
    x8=3    x=3+8=5x - 8 = -3 \implies x = -3 + 8 = 5
    Answer: 5

  5. -2 + ____ = 1
    To solve for the blank:
    2+x=1    x=1+2=3-2 + x = 1 \implies x = 1 + 2 = 3
    Answer: 3

  6. ____ - 12 = -4
    To solve for the blank:
    x12=4    x=4+12=8x - 12 = -4 \implies x = -4 + 12 = 8
    Answer: 8

Code:

26 - 2 - 11 - 5 - 3 - 8
